대유행 인플루엔자(H1N1 2009) 원내 노출자 관리결과
이경원,권오미,이동숙,박은숙,김창오,한상훈,김기환,이주현,하은진,이경원 대한의료관련감염관리학회 2010 의료관련감염관리 Vol.15 No.2
Background: This study is aimed at describing the outcomes of the management of the patients, caregivers, and healthcare workers (HCWs) who are exposed to the pandemic influenza (H1N1 2009) virus and at evaluating the adequacy in exposure management and infection control. Methods: From July 2009 to January 2010, for 7 a month period, we managed patients and healthcare workers without any respiratory protective devices, who came within 1 m distance of H1N1-positive individuals for more than 1h and performed a 1-week follow-up. Results: The total of 157 cases with exposure to pandemic influenza (H1N1 2009) virus and exposed individuals of 907 were reported. Of the exposed individuals who were under management, 15 were confirmed to be infected with the infection rate being 1.7%. The confirmed individuals did not have a secondary infection after the exposure. Rates of infection of the exposed patients and healthcare workers were 1.8% and 1.6%, respectively, and these figures were not statistically significant. Conclusion: The exposure management results at the hospital revealed that the infection had spread by contact with individuals who were positive for the infection. The high incidence of early exposure to the virus warrants the need to ensure the use of protective equipment and the adoption of assertive teaching methods that have long lasting effects.

李京遠 충주대 2001 한국교통대학교 논문집 Vol.36 No.2
키토산을 약산에 용해시켜서 H+이온에 의한 가수분해를 진행시킨 뒤 동결 건조시켜서 수용성 키토산을 제조하였다.키토산의 분자량은 초산농도증가와 온도가 증가할수록 점점 감소하는데 이는 가수분해가 활성화되기 때문임을 알 수 있었다.또한 동결건조시에는 수분제거와 함께 초산의 증발도 함께 진행되어 키토산의 pH에 영향을 미침을 알았다. The chitosan, which performed the process of freeze drying after dissolution in weak acid, was retarded the hydrolysis caused by proton ion and showed water soluble capacity due to the salt form of chitosan structure.The molecular weight of chitosan was decreased with the increase of acetic acid and the increase of temperature.It can be seen that the molecular weight of chitosan was influenced by the activation of hydrolysis.During freeze drying process, the pH of chitosan was also affected by the volatilization of acetic acid with the elimination of water.
Holography에 의한 Loudspeaker Cone의 振動에 관한 考察
李慶源,朴鍾允,林鍾洙,朴興秀 成均館大學校 科學技術硏究所 1984 論文集 Vol.35 No.1
Optical holographic interferometry is used to study the forced vibrational cone behaviour at some frequencies and photographs of resultant hologragm images are included. The entire cone vibrates almost uniformly in the low frequency region. Above certain frequency both transverse and longitudinal waves are coupled and together determine the vibration patterns. The coupling between longitudinal and bending waves gives rise to an antiresonance that the transverse amplitude become large. Bending waves only occur above the frequency at which this antiresonance occur. As the frequency increases, the resonance effect gradually progresses from the outer edge to the inner edge.
